How they compare
Israel currently reports 28.4% against 26.4% in South Africa, a difference of 2.0%.
That makes Israel's figure about 1.1 times South Africa's.
Across all 11 years both countries report, Israel has been ahead every year.
Israel ranks 41st and South Africa ranks 44th of 144 countries.
Israel has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Israel | South Africa |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 11.5% | 5.6% | 5.9% | Israel |
| 1970s | 21.5% | 5.8% | 15.6% | Israel |
| 1980s | 23.4% | 5.2% | 18.2% | Israel |
| 1990s | 19.4% | 12.4% | 7.0% | Israel |
| 2000s | 20.0% | 12.7% | 7.3% | Israel |
| 2010s | 28.4% | 26.4% | 2.0% | Israel |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
